Why People Visit Thames Rockets
Thrilling Experience
The main reason tourists go to Thames Rockets is for the thrill. Its speed boat drives give a taste of adrenaline that is very hard to imitate. You ride a speed boat across the water at 35 miles per hour times and, out of the blue, are winding through fast turns. That kind of ride makes for a very exhilarating adventure.
Unique Sightseeing Opportunity
Thames Rockets offers an entirely different angle on the city tour. This boat tour differs from the traditional way of looking at the city. One can watch the city from the waterside and see unobstructed views, such as the Tower of London, St. Paul's Cathedral, and the London Eye. The guides talk about pretty amusing stuff and tell exciting and interesting stories and facts, which are entertaining and educational.

Useful Information for Visitors
Opening Hours
Thames Rockets operates all year round and leads tours regularly throughout. The common time spans are from 10 AM to 6 PM, and the timetable is the key factor in the schedule, though this shifts due to weather and the season. During high tourist seasons, additional excursions may be arranged to handle the increase in demand.
Ticket Prices
Thames Rockets tour prices include a discount based on the tour type and the passengers' age. The following is a general breakdown of the pricing:
Adult Ticket (16+ years): £50-£60
Child Ticket (14 years and under): £35-£45
Family Ticket (2 adults and two children): £160-£180
Private Charter: Prices vary with the duration and the specifics of the charter
Group bookings, schools, and corporate events revealed special offers and early discounts. So, the Thames Rockets website is the best resource for checking current pricing and available discounts.
